There’s actually no such thing as in transit weights, at least not something that’s visible to the public. Even internally, USPS will mostly go by the weight provided by the shipper on the label. Unless they suspect a huge discrepancy, the package will scan through without getting flagged for a weight difference so in most cases, their backend will show the ship weight on the label. Which is whatever the shipper provides.

The reason we began inquiring about scan weights is because a lot of USPS returns started coming in as empty packages. The weight on the label would show 1 lb for example, but the actual weight of the empty would be closer to 6 oz. The scammers would always claim their packages were tampered with in transit by postal workers so we would try obtaining internal scan weights from USPS, only to be told the only weights they have in their system were the label weights.

Google AI generally confirms this as well:

“USPS tracking typically does not publicly display the in-transit, real-time weight of a package on their website. While sorting machines and post offices weigh packages to verify postage, this information is used internally for audit purposes. The weight is usually only listed on the sender's receipt or the original shipping label detail”.

TLDR: Depending on which market you’re in, the vast majority of USPS offices in our area that we’ve encountered do not weigh each and every package to confirm actual weight, they mostly go by shipper-provided label weight. Source: several USPS workers over the years.
